How much is an Uber from Miami airport to cruise port?

An Uber/Lyft fare from the Miami airport to the Port of Miami would run approximately $20, compared to $27 flat-rate for a taxi. If flying into Fort Lauderdale, the fare is around $35 to the Miami cruise port, compared to roughly $75 for a taxi. Keep in mind these rates are per car, not per person.

How do I get from Miami airport to the port?

What’s the Best Way to Get From Miami Airport to Cruise Port?

  1. Cruise Shuttle – around $17 per person.
  2. Private Airport Shuttle – $20-40 per vehicle.
  3. Taxi – $27 per vehicle fixed rate.
  4. Uber/Lyft – $20 per vehicle.
  5. Private Car – From $100 for a luxury sedan.
  6. Private Van – Around $125 per vehicle.

How much is the shuttle to Miami cruise port?

Many of the cruise lines offer transfer service from the Miami and Fort Lauderdale airports to the cruise terminals. Carnival, for example, offers a shuttle from the Miami airport to your cruise for around $17 one-way/$34 round trip per person. The same shuttle runs about $32 one-way/$65 round-trip per person from the Fort Lauderdale airport.
